Having just finished the biography of Philip K Dick(I am alive and you are dead) I found myself wondering how valid are our views on what constitutes reality.
I myself have never experienced the awful paranoia, nor the earth shaking visions and feelings of transcendance, that Dick did. I have however had some chemical induced sleights of mind that allow me to put forward my own views on what I believe reality to be. Reality is what is real to you, and everything experienced is valid.
With XTC coursing through my system one evening, I had the odd, and rather disconcerting sensation that I was in two different rooms at the same time. This was real, and I was so disorientated that I had to be taken next door to a friends house so as not to alarm my parents.
Now any neuroscientist worth his salt would say that this was just an altered sense of perception brought about by the action of MDMA working on the receptors of the brain and causing something akin to an out of body experience. And that neuroscientist would be right.
But even a state of mind so drastically different to our everyday life could be said to be real, on its own terms. The sense of being in two places at the same time, no matter how such an effect was acheived, was real at the time of experiencing it and constituted solid reality at that time. In those moments I was really in two places at the same time. Make of it what you will.
